Description of Kombucha


Kombucha is a carbonated tea-based drink that many drink for its health benefits or medicinal reasons. There is scientific info that support health benefits but few studies have been conducted mainly due to the very high cost of such medical studies. There are many centuries of popular stories telling of health benefits attributed to the tea.

Kombucha is available commercially but can most easily be prepared by fermenting tea using a spongy mass of yeast and bacteria often nicknamed a SCOBY. This forms the kombucha culture which is also most commonly referred to as the "mushroom" but it is not a true mushroom. It grows surface of the tea during the period of time the tea is fermenting and resembles a near whitish colored pancake.
